Are you a resilient and motivated Teaching Assistant looking for a role where you can make a genuine difference to young people who need support the most? This secondary Alternative Provision in South Birmingham is seeking a Teaching Assistant to support students with challenging behaviours and social, emotional and mental health needs.
This role is ideal for someone who enjoys building positive relationships, understands the barriers young people face, and remains calm under pressure. As a Teaching Assistant you will be supporting students on a 1‑2‑1 basis, managing behaviours and helping them to regulate their behaviours. This role requires a Teaching Assistant who has previous experience supporting young people who have faced academic or social barriers. You will be joining a welcoming and supportive team of Teaching Assistants and Teachers who are determined to make a difference.
